Jacomo Paris Eau de Jacomo is an Eau de Toilette launched in 1980, created by Christian Mathieu. Eau de Jacomo opens with Grapefruit, Lime, Cardamom, and Galbanum, settles into a heart of Cyclamen, Cypress, Rosewood, and Iris, and dries down to a base of Musk, Amber, Cedar, and Patchouli. Jacomo Paris's Eau de Jacomo carries an Acquired verdict, a warm spicy-led wear.

Jacomo de Jacomo is a divisive, full-throttle 80s powerhouse. It's not for the faint of heart, blending pungent spice and smoke with a rugged masculinity many adore, and others detest. This one's an acquired taste, darling.

About

Imagine stepping into a dimly lit, wood-panelled room, the air thick with the aroma of mulled wine and burning spices. Jacomo de Jacomo opens with bracing grapefruit and lime, quickly deepened by an assertive blend of warm spices-think clove, cumin, and cinnamon. Earthy oakmoss and aromatic herbs like basil and sage intertwine with a smoky aura, settling into a complex, brooding leather-like drydown with hints of musk and patchouli that evokes vintage charm.
